Q: Is 12,558,158 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 12,558,158 is a composite number.

Why is 12,558,158 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 12,558,158 can be evenly divided by 1 2 773 1,546 8,123 16,246 6,279,079 and 12,558,158, with no remainder.

Since 12,558,158 cannot be divided by just 1 and 12,558,158, it is a composite number.
